The Underdog Part 2 Friends of the Dumpster.



The night dawned, and the lights which resembled millions of stars like those in the sky flickered. Browny, was overjoyed and overwhelmed at the same time. He had never seen these kinds of lights in the dump yard, which only had a couple of lights at the gate. He walked towards the teeming lights, and slowly these lights took shape. Upon reaching the outskirts, he came upon the sprawling suburban area that marked the periphery of the city.  And to his surprise, there were a few dogs who came to him, smelled him, and asked him about where he came from and where he was going. He told the whole story about the red cloth, the dog in the car, and how he lost his way to the dump yard. 

The other dogs, who were confused at this little pup, who had lost his way asked him to go back, for the city will eat him alive. Browny was now oscillating, he was at the crossroad, he could go where his loving mother was, but the place stunk like anything or he could brave the streets of the city and get into the car. And he needed to ponder only a little for he wanted to get into the car like the dog he saw. He chose to stay. Trouble started as he looked towards the city, the growling of just a few moments before kind dogs suggested that though abundant the real estate of the city is divided by each dog having his area marked. Natural instincts put the tail between his legs as the little pup was driven towards the city from the suburb, everywhere he went dogs chased him away. this all chasing and not tending to his little tummy, made him tired and his legs shook, he walked with a little tremble in his legs, and slowly he came to a dumpster where a lonely dog was going through the treasures of the day.

The dog, who was so busy, sniffing and going through items in the dumpster, only became aware of the Browny when Browny came too close and the smell that came with him disturbed the smell of the dumpster. The dog was first afraid of getting caught in the middle of the treasure and a very big dog put the tail between the leg and slowly looked back and found a small puppy shivering and hungry, and looking expectantly at him. He immediately got the courage, he came upon the puppy, smelled him asked about him and he could get only a few sensible muttered growls. Upon which he again went back to the dumpster.

For Browny, this dog that enquired after him at the dumpster seemed kind of all the dogs he met. He could only tell him, that he lived far from here and was hungry before his legs gave away and he sat on the spot. He watched the dog climb back into the dumpster and slowly his eyelids, heavy from the fatigue and hunger, were closing upon him. The dog in the dumpster was becoming blur moment by moment when he was no more and there was only darkness. Browny was at peace, now the hunger was no more nor there was fatigue. slowly darkness gave away to bright light and he felt light. He felt like floating but something was tugging him, holding him down. he looked down there was no one but only white mist he looked up and there was mist again.. he looked around and everywhere the mist surrounded him. The tugging was now frequent and he heard a faint growl and bark in repetitions. Since he could not now go up in the mist, he decided to go down and look for the source of tugging and the bark. slowly the mist faded into darkness and there was now the sensation of someone pulling his tail, the growl and bark which was faint in the mist were now becoming clearer and loud. Somehow he managed to open his eyelids a little and found a faint figure urging him to get up and was pushing something towards him with his paws and nose. Browny tough too tired summoned the strength he never had to open his eyelids and found the dog from the dumpster urging him to get up and was pointing at the food(a half-eaten sandwich)he brought to him. Browny slowly stood up, took the sandwich in his mouth, and ate hungrily. The energy that came from the food, rushed through his veins and his bites on the sandwich become stronger with every new bite. Browny found the strength, and the dog from the dumpster who watched him eat sat guard so as not to allow anyone to disturb the meal of this little pup. He looked at him one and one moment at the long night. For many eyes were now looking at the dumpster from the blanket of the night. 


As Browny finished his sandwich, he looked for the dog who on a sudden whim, urged him to follow and browny followed. the dog quickened his space and soon they were both far from the dumpster and the dog stopped for a moment and looked back at the dumpster. So did Browny, they both saw that the dumpster which was quiet as night overran with barks and growls of the big dogs they were a group who hunted for food at night, the vagabonds of the streets, and even from afar, a dog's eyes would not miss the wounds sustained by them from the fights. The dog from the dumpster urged again to follow and after a long walk that seemed like miles, from the gullies and gutter channels to the crevices and under the gates Browny came to a quiet place in the front was a lonely cement pipe which resembled a presence from eternity with overgrown weeds,, brackish cement and protruding and exposed rusted iron, nested in the rags and dirt. this was the home of the dog from the dumpster. He invited Browny to his cozy and peaceful home. Browny saw a hoard of things in the pipe from the rags of different colors to bits and pieces of different objects. there was a little pot where the water was collected from the rain channel and served as a drinking spot. Browny hurried lapped his tongue in the cool water satisfying his thirst and cooling his body.

When the basic instincts were satisfied, Browny asked about the dog who was so kind to offer him food, water, and shelter and helped him survive. When he asked his name, he didn't have any for he was an orphan. Browny wanted to have him a name and baptized him with the name of  Raggy. Raggy liked the name, it was better than having none. and he showed his affection by wagging his tail.

That night, these two friends slept peacefully... dreaming better tomorrow and a better world.
